2006 NAIA Division II Men's Basketball All-Americans




First Team

Name

Institution

Pos.

Yr.

Ht.

Hometown

#*Shea Washington

Southern Oregon University

F

Sr

6'7

Springfield, Ore.

Michael Bonaparte

College of the Ozarks (Mo.)

F

Jr

6'4

Grande Valley, Grenada

Antonio Davis

Urbana University (Ohio)

F

Sr

6'6

Columbus, Ohio

*Eric Fiegi

Corban College (Ore.)

C

Sr

6'9

Medford, Ore.

Eric Ford

Taylor University (Ind.)

G

Sr

6'0

Indianapolis, Ind.

Alex Kock

Huntington University (Ind.)

F

Jr

6'5

Auburn, Ind.

Drew Mathews

William Jewell College (Mo.)

F

Sr

6'4

Olathe, Kan.

Michael Pyle

Embry-Riddle University (Fla.)

F

Sr

6'6

Ormond Beach, Fla.

Chad Schuiteman

Northwestern College  (Iowa)

F

So

6'6

Sioux Center, Iowa

Jonny Viehland

Lindenwood University (Mo.)

F

Sr

6'6

New Haven, Mo.

 

#2006 NAIA Division II Men's Basketball Player of the Year
* - Repeat first-team All-American from 2005
